Output 36a10975e33371fbcafb3a4278e705626c74a420ee23484160296e2504afbd11:70

value
134354
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ccc434d822b54d71a2d9cf40e1e9bc3b7bc52c04 OP_EQUAL
address
3LMipLaiCUpFNrWhvvG2cEKGQgzrEFUxVb
transaction
36a10975e33371fbcafb3a4278e705626c74a420ee23484160296e2504afbd11
spent
true